Asymptotic Study of Divorce Model with Pre-Marriage Preparedness as Control

Abstract:
Peaceful cohabitation in a marriage institution is challenged with separation/divorce because of distinct individual psychological build-up. A deterministic model for the divorce epidemic was proposed using standard incidence as a forcing function. The stability theory of differential equations was used to perform the model analysis qualitatively on which the equilibria obtained are locally and globally stable. Bifurcation and sensitivity analysis of the model were performed; parameters responsible for managing and eradicating the spread of divorce in marriages were determined. A numerical simulation was performed with results that showed pre-marriage preparedness and conscientious growth in tolerance of individual differences as a stabilizer to marriages.
